Summary:

ZIP code 80121 is home to three elementary schools—Lois Lenski Elementary School, Gudy Gaskill Elementary, and Field Elementary School—serving grades K-5 across Centennial and Littleton, Colorado, all part of the highly rated Littleton School District No. 6, which ranks 8th out of 115 Colorado districts.

These three schools share the same ZIP code and district, yet their academic profiles could hardly be more different. Lois Lenski is the clear standout: it ranks 49th out of 943 Colorado elementary schools (95th percentile, 5 stars), with ELA proficiency at 74.5%, math at 70.1%, and science at 61.4%—all well above district and state averages. It also has the lowest chronic absenteeism (9.1%) and the lowest free/reduced lunch rate (11.2%) in the group. Gudy Gaskill is a solid above-average performer (82nd percentile, 4 stars), with math and science proficiency above district averages, but its ELA proficiency (60.5%) dips slightly below the district (62.1%), and its state rank has slipped modestly over the past three years. Field Elementary, by contrast, is struggling: it ranks in the 25th percentile (1 star), with proficiency rates at or below 28.6% in ELA and math, and just 15% in science—less than half the state averages. Field also has the highest chronic absenteeism (30.1%) and a free/reduced lunch rate of nearly 74%, the highest by a wide margin.

The most striking finding is the enormous achievement gap within this single ZIP code—Lois Lenski and Field are 658 places apart in state rankings, with a 46-percentage-point gap in science proficiency alone. Poverty and attendance strongly track with these differences: Field's free/reduced lunch rate is 6.6 times higher than Lois Lenski's, and its chronic absenteeism is roughly triple. Perhaps most surprising, Field has the smallest class sizes (12.2 students per teacher) compared to Lois Lenski (18.5), yet performs far worse—a reminder that factors like poverty and attendance often outweigh student-teacher ratios. Meanwhile, Lois Lenski is improving its state rank year over year, while Field has stalled or declined. For parents, this ZIP code offers a microcosm of educational inequality: a top-tier school, a reliable middle option, and a school in urgent need of targeted support and intervention.
